>> ================================================
>> == What justifies a -1 vote for this release? ==
>> ================================================
>> This vote is happening towards the end of the 1.6 QA period, so -1 votes
>> should only occur for significant regressions from 1.5. Bugs already
>> present in 1.5, minor regressions, or bugs related to new features will not
>> block this release.
>>
>> ===============================================================
>> == What should happen to JIRA tickets still targeting 1.6.0? ==
>> ===============================================================
>> 1. It is OK for documentation patches to target 1.6.0 and still go into
>> branch-1.6, since documentations will be published separately from the
>> release.
>> 2. New features for non-alpha-modules should target 1.7+.
>> 3. Non-blocker bug fixes should target 1.6.1 or 1.7.0, or drop the target
>> version.

>> Notable Features Since 1.5Spark SQL
>>
>>    - SPARK-11787 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11787> Parquet
>>    Performance - Improve Parquet scan performance when using flat
>>    schemas.
>>    - SPARK-10810 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10810>
>>    Session Management - Isolated devault database (i.e USE mydb) even on
>>    shared clusters.
>>    - SPARK-9999  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9999> Dataset
>>    API - A type-safe API (similar to RDDs) that performs many operations
>>    on serialized binary data and code generation (i.e. Project Tungsten).
>>    - SPARK-10000 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10000> Unified
>>    Memory Management - Shared memory for execution and caching instead
>>    of exclusive division of the regions.
>>    - SPARK-11197 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11197> SQL
>>    Queries on Files - Concise syntax for running SQL queries over files
>>    of any supported format without registering a table.
>>    - SPARK-11745 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11745> Reading
>>    non-standard JSON files - Added options to read non-standard JSON
>>    files (e.g. single-quotes, unquoted attributes)
>>    - SPARK-10412 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10412> 
>> Per-operator
>>    Metrics for SQL Execution - Display statistics on a peroperator basis
>>    for memory usage and spilled data size.
>>    - SPARK-11329 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11329> Star
>>    (*) expansion for StructTypes - Makes it easier to nest and unest
>>    arbitrary numbers of columns
>>    - SPARK-10917 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10917>,
>>    SPARK-11149 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11149> In-memory
>>    Columnar Cache Performance - Significant (up to 14x) speed up when
>>    caching data that contains complex types in DataFrames or SQL.
>>    - SPARK-11111 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11111> Fast
>>    null-safe joins - Joins using null-safe equality (<=>) will now
>>    execute using SortMergeJoin instead of computing a cartisian product.
>>    - SPARK-11389 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11389> SQL
>>    Execution Using Off-Heap Memory - Support for configuring query
>>    execution to occur using off-heap memory to avoid GC overhead
>>    - SPARK-10978 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10978> 
>> Datasource
>>    API Avoid Double Filter - When implemeting a datasource with filter
>>    pushdown, developers can now tell Spark SQL to avoid double evaluating a
>>    pushed-down filter.
>>    - SPARK-4849  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-4849> Advanced
>>    Layout of Cached Data - storing partitioning and ordering schemes in
>>    In-memory table scan, and adding distributeBy and localSort to DF API
>>    - SPARK-9858  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9858> Adaptive
>>    query execution - Intial support for automatically selecting the
>>    number of reducers for joins and aggregations.
>>    - SPARK-9241  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9241> Improved
>>    query planner for queries having distinct aggregations - Query plans
>>    of distinct aggregations are more robust when distinct columns have high
>>    cardinality.

>> Spark Streaming
>>
>>    - API Updates
>>       - SPARK-2629  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-2629> New
>>       improved state management - mapWithState - a DStream
>>       transformation for stateful stream processing, supercedes
>>       updateStateByKey in functionality and performance.
>>       - SPARK-11198 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-11198> 
>> Kinesis
>>       record deaggregation - Kinesis streams have been upgraded to use
>>       KCL 1.4.0 and supports transparent deaggregation of KPL-aggregated 
>> records.
>>       - SPARK-10891 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10891> 
>> Kinesis
>>       message handler function - Allows arbitraray function to be
>>       applied to a Kinesis record in the Kinesis receiver before to customize
>>       what data is to be stored in memory.
>>       - SPARK-6328  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-6328> Python
>>       Streamng Listener API - Get streaming statistics (scheduling
>>       delays, batch processing times, etc.) in streaming.
>>
>>
>>    - UI Improvements
>>       - Made failures visible in the streaming tab, in the timelines,
>>       batch list, and batch details page.
>>       - Made output operations visible in the streaming tab as progress
>>       bars.

>> MLlibNew algorithms/models
>>
>>    - SPARK-8518  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-8518> Survival
>>    analysis - Log-linear model for survival analysis
>>    - SPARK-9834  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9834> Normal
>>    equation for least squares - Normal equation solver, providing R-like
>>    model summary statistics
>>    - SPARK-3147  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-3147> Online
>>    hypothesis testing - A/B testing in the Spark Streaming framework
>>    - SPARK-9930  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9930> New
>>    feature transformers - ChiSqSelector, QuantileDiscretizer, SQL
>>    transformer
>>    - SPARK-6517  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-6517> Bisecting
>>    K-Means clustering - Fast top-down clustering variant of K-Means
>>
>> API improvements
>>
>>    - ML Pipelines
>>       - SPARK-6725  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-6725> 
>> Pipeline
>>       persistence - Save/load for ML Pipelines, with partial coverage of
>>       spark.ml algorithms
>>       - SPARK-5565  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-5565> LDA
>>       in ML Pipelines - API for Latent Dirichlet Allocation in ML
>>       Pipelines
>>    - R API
>>       - SPARK-9836  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9836> R-like
>>       statistics for GLMs - (Partial) R-like stats for ordinary least
>>       squares via summary(model)
>>       - SPARK-9681  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9681> 
>> Feature
>>       interactions in R formula - Interaction operator ":" in R formula
>>    - Python API - Many improvements to Python API to approach feature
>>    parity
>>
>> Misc improvements
>>
>>    - SPARK-7685  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-7685>,
>>    SPARK-9642  <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-9642> Instance
>>    weights for GLMs - Logistic and Linear Regression can take instance
>>    weights
>>    - SPARK-10384 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10384>,
>>    SPARK-10385 <https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-10385> Univariate
>>    and bivariate statistics in DataFrames - Variance, stddev,
>>    correlations, etc.
